<Project>
- <UsingTask TaskName="GenDummyTask" AssemblyFile="$(MSBuildThisFileDirectory)tasks\GenDummy.Tasks.dll" />
+ <Import Project="$(MSBuildThisFileDirectory)profiles.targets" />
- <Target Name="CopyToArtifactsDirectory"
- Condition="'$(ArtifactsDirectory)' != ''"
- DependsOnTargets="GetCopyToOutputDirectoryItems">
- <ItemGroup>
- <OutputFilesToCopy Include="$(OutDir)**" />
- </ItemGroup>
- <Copy SourceFiles="@(OutputFilesToCopy)"
- DestinationFiles="$(ArtifactsDirectory)%(RecursiveDir)%(Filename)%(Extension)" />
- </Target>
+ <PropertyGroup>
+ <__PostBuildDependsOn>
+ _CopyPreloadFilesToOutDir;
+ GenerateProfileFileList;
+ </__PostBuildDependsOn>
+ </PropertyGroup>
- <Target Name="CopyToDummyArtifactsDirectory"
- DependsOnTargets="GetCopyToOutputDirectoryItems">
- <Copy SourceFiles="$(TargetPath)"
- DestinationFiles="$(OutputDummyDir)$(TargetFileName)" />
+ <Target Name="__PostBuild"
+ AfterTargets="Build"
+ DependsOnTargets="$(__PostBuildDependsOn)">
</Target>
- <Target Name="BeforeCompile"
- Condition="'$(IsDummyBuild)' == 'True'">
+ <Target Name="_CopyPreloadFilesToOutDir">
+
+ <Copy SourceFiles="@(TizenPreloadFile)"
+ DestinationFiles="$(OutDir)%(Sequence).%(Filename)%(Extension)" />
- <GenDummyTask Sources="@(Compile)" OutputDirectory="$(IntermediateOutputPath)dummy\">
- <Output TaskParameter="GeneratedFiles" ItemName="_DummyCompile" />
- </GenDummyTask>
- <ItemGroup>
- <Compile Remove="@(Compile)" />
- <Compile Include="@(_DummyCompile)" />
- </ItemGroup>
</Target>
</Project>